The increasing number of unmanned aerial vehicle poses new \udchallenges in the \udaviation industry especially the air traffic control, which \udis responsible for the \udsafe flight operations in the controlled airspaces. In order \udto protect the \udconventional aircraft a new operation environment has to be \udcreated, which \udguarantee the safe flying and the possibility of the \udfulfilment of the flight. In \udthe article drone related safety and operational problems are \udhighlighted. All \udissue connected to the coexistence of manned and unmanned \udaircrafts are critical, \udthus their management have significant importance.\udSpread and wide use of unmanned aerial vehicle traffic \udmanagement systems (UTM) can \udmanage the critical operational issues, but is has to be \uddefined that what is the \udproblem, what is the scope, what is the operational \udenvironment. Services and \udfunctions related to the operation of the UTM system are \uddefined, which are \udnecessary for the safe flying fulfilled by the unmanned \udvehicles
